Yes, absolutely! A confetti machine can create a truly magical and unforgettable moment at a wedding. The shower of colorful pieces floating through the air captures stunning photographs and creates a celebratory atmosphere that guests will remember for years to come. But only if you plan it carefully and get permission first. Whether you're dreaming of a grand exit showered in biodegradable confetti or a magical first dance under a gentle flutter of white tissue, proper planning ensures your confetti moment becomes a highlight rather than a headache.
Before you get your heart set on that picture-perfect confetti moment, this golden rule cannot be overstated: always check with your venue first. Many wedding venues have specific policies about confetti machines due to cleanup concerns or environmental considerations. Having this conversation early in your planning process can save you from disappointment later.
Pro Tip: Always get the venue's confetti policy in writing, either in your contract or through email confirmation. This prevents any misunderstandings on your wedding day.

Timing is everything when it comes to confetti at weddings. The right moment can create an unforgettable highlight in your celebration. Here are the most popular times to incorporate a confetti machine at your wedding:
The classic choice. A huge blast of confetti as you run through a line of your friends and family. This creates a joyful finale to your ceremony and spectacular photo opportunities. Position the confetti machine at the end of your exit path for maximum impact.
A gentle, continuous shower of slow-fall confetti during the peak of your song can be incredibly romantic. The floating pieces catch the light and create a dreamy, ethereal atmosphere that enhances this intimate moment between newlyweds.
A perfectly timed burst as you have your first kiss as a married couple. (Check with your officiant and venue!) This surprise element adds excitement to the ceremony conclusion and creates a celebratory atmosphere immediately.
Launch confetti to signal that the formal part of the evening is over and the party is starting. This energizes guests and creates a festive atmosphere that encourages everyone to join the celebration on the dance floor.
Beyond choosing the right type and timing, these practical considerations will help ensure your confetti moment goes smoothly:
Assign a specific person (not in your wedding party) to be responsible for operating the confetti machine. This could be your wedding coordinator, a trusted friend, or a venue staff member. Make sure they know exactly when to trigger the confetti and have tested the machine beforehand.
For a standard wedding exit with 100 guests, about 1-2 pounds of confetti creates a good effect. For a first dance or smaller moment, half a pound may be sufficient. It's better to have slightly too much than not enough for your special moment.
Even with biodegradable confetti, have a cleanup plan in place. Bring a few brooms and dustpans for indoor events. For outdoor celebrations with biodegradable confetti, check if the venue allows it to decompose naturally or requires immediate cleanup.
Want to involve your guests in the confetti fun? Consider these alternatives to a centralized confetti machine that allow everyone to participate:
These handheld launchers let guests create their own mini confetti shower with a flick of the wrist. They're perfect for guest participation and can be customized with your names and wedding date as favors.
Pre-filled paper cones with biodegradable confetti allow guests to toss confetti at the perfect moment. These can be displayed in decorative baskets or trays near your ceremony exit for easy access.
For venues with strict no-confetti policies, bubble machines create a magical effect with zero cleanup. The bubbles catch the light beautifully in photos and are universally venue-friendly.
